Transaction 8d654585653d37d95709a1dbb1149ce8662e57a35d2f90059a202437ede9263c

1 Input
2 Outputs
  • 8d654585653d37d95709a1dbb1149ce8662e57a35d2f90059a202437ede9263c:0
  • value  143510
    address  12KxaD9pmSeWExQsr5o3LtsnyCBWkVY3MA
  • 8d654585653d37d95709a1dbb1149ce8662e57a35d2f90059a202437ede9263c:1
  • value  51426139
    address  3Pz8qdtALoLRQA2NYoe7Ptc7kykqaBEDx2